Restoring Comfort and Control with Thermal Solutions After Major Floor at Smithtown Library: HVAC Overhaul


Overview

When a flash flood in August 2024 devastated Smithtown Library’s mechanical systems, time was of the essence. Klima New York partnered with Thermal Solutions, the project’s mechanical contractor, to rapidly supply and support the implementation of a new HVAC system—focused on speed, cost-effectiveness, reliability, and long-term design flexibility.

 

The Challenge

The flood left the library’s entire mechanical infrastructure inoperable, requiring a full HVAC system replacement under urgent conditions. Klima New York was brought in to supply the critical equipment and deliver expert controls integration to ensure a cohesive, high-performance system. Working alongside the mechanical contractor, Klima played a key role in meeting tight deadlines and high expectations for reliability, efficiency, and design.

 

The Solution

Klima New York worked closely with Thermal Solutions to deliver a fully integrated HVAC system tailored to the library’s layout and operational needs. The equipment package supplied by Klima included:

  1. LG Chiller and DFS Systems – Chosen for their compact footprint, energy efficiency, and proven reliability.
  2. VTS Air Handlers – Selected for their fast lead times, cost-effective pricing, and dependable performance,e and designed for effective ventilation and seamless integration with other system components.
  3. Hydronic Specialties Equipment – Including pumps, starters, and VFDs to enhance overall system performance while controlling costs.
  4. Klima Controls Integration – JCI and Honeywell platforms were integrated to centralize system control of the chiller, pumps, AHUs, and DFS systems.
  5. Klima coordinated directly with Thermal Solutions to ensure equipment delivery, setup, and controls commissioning were completed smoothly and on schedule.

Project Benefits

  1. Accelerated Implementation – Rapid equipment supply and streamlined coordination enabled on-time reopening.
  2. Cost-Effective Design – Equipment choices and integration strategies kept the project within budget without sacrificing quality.
  3. Reliable Infrastructure – Robust systems and centralized controls provide lasting performance and easier maintenance.
  4. Thoughtful Engineering – The entire system was designed for efficiency, flexibility, and long-term value.

Together, Klima New York and Thermal Solutions restored comfort and control to Smithtown Library—just in time for the grand reopening, with an HVAC system built to serve for years to come.

Maintaining Architectural Integrity through Heat Pump Installation


Objectives

Built from the ground up, 531 Avenue of the Americas is notable for its distinctive design. With such eye-catching curb appeal, the proper HVAC system needed to be installed while ensuring its lack of visibility from the outside. Thus, it was KLIMA’s mission to incorporate a high-performance, high-efficient heat pump system that fits in the building — all without compromising its architectural integrity.

 

Problems

The biggest challenge stemming from this project came from the condenser’s visibility. It was the client’s desire that the condenser remained obscured from view to maintain the visual and architectural appeal of the unique building. In turn, KLIMA had to come up with a Solution to fit 12 MV 5 and 2 MV S condensers inside of the bulkhead, which was enclosed with an architectural louver.

 

Solutions

With KLIMA’s ingenuity, we were able to fit 14 condensers inside of the bulkhead and enclose it with an architectural louver. These louvers were designed to have the required free area to accommodate the airflow needed for the condensers. KLIMA was ultimately successful in implementing a high-performance HVAC system, all while adhering to the client request of obscuring condensers and maintaining architectural integrity.

 

Benefits

  • Ultra High efficient HVAC system
  • Maintained visual/architectural aesthetic
  • Demonstrated KLIMA’s aptitude and ability to adapt to unique, challenging situations
